Here are some things to do in Garmisch-Partenkirchen:
- Zugspitze: Visit Germany's highest mountain and enjoy breathtaking panoramic views.
- Partnach Gorge: Hike through the dramatic gorge and witness the power of nature.
- Werdenfels Castle: Discover the ruins of this medieval castle and learn about its fascinating history.
- Lake Eibsee: Relax on the shores of this crystal-clear lake, go for a swim, or rent a paddleboat.
- Olympic Ski Jump: Admire the impressive ski jump used for the 1936 Winter Olympics and enjoy the views from the top.
- Ludwigstraße: Stroll down this charming street lined with shops, cafes, and traditional Bavarian architecture.
- Kramerplateauweg: Embark on a scenic hike along this panoramic trail with stunning views of the surrounding mountains.
- Local Beer Tasting: Experience the rich Bavarian beer culture by trying out local breweries and traditional beer gardens.
- Alpine Coaster: Get an adrenaline rush on this roller coaster-like toboggan ride through the mountains.
- Garmisch-Partenkirchen Museum: Immerse yourself in the history and culture of the region through interactive exhibits and artifacts.

Best time to visit Garmisch-Partenkirchen
Garmisch-Partenkirchen, Germany offers spectacular natural beauty throughout the year. The best time to visit is from May to October when the weather is pleasant, and outdoor activities like hiking and biking are at their best. However, if you are a winter sports enthusiast, the snowy months from November to April are perfect for skiing and snowboarding. Keep in mind that peak tourist season is during the summer months, so expect larger crowds and higher prices.

How to get to Garmisch-Partenkirchen
By Plane
The most convenient international airports for reaching Garmisch-Partenkirchen are Munich (MUC) and Innsbruck (INN). Munich Airport offers excellent global connections and is only a 1.5-hour train ride away. Innsbruck Airport is closer, with regular flights from major European cities. Both options provide seamless transfers and convenient access to the destination.
By other means
Garmisch-Partenkirchen is easily accessible by train. The city has its own train station, offering frequent connections to major cities like Munich and Innsbruck. Buses are also available, providing convenient transportation within the region.
